Lawful Considerations for Redundancy



Legal considerations for redundancy have to be carefully navigated by business to make certain conformity with relevant regulations and regulations. When executing redundancies, it is vital for employers to comply with the lawful structure developed by labor legislations to safeguard the rights of workers. One key facet to think about is guaranteeing that the choice standards for redundancy are reasonable, non-discriminatory, and based upon legit business reasons.


Employers have to additionally give proper notice to employees that go to danger of redundancy as mandated by legislation. This includes informing workers of the reasons for redundancy, the selection process, and any kind of privileges they may have, such as redundancy pay or alternative employment options. Failure to comply with notification needs can lead to legal consequences for the firm.

Furthermore, companies should think about any cumulative examination commitments that might apply if a specific number of workers are at risk of redundancy within a specific time framework. By comprehending and complying with these legal factors to consider, firms can navigate the redundancy procedure efficiently while upholding their lawful obligations to employees.

Retraining and Redeployment Programs



These programs are important components of a responsible redundancy strategy that focuses on worker well-being and retention. Re-training efforts supply workers with the chance to get brand-new skills or enhance existing ones, increasing their worth to the business.


Redeployment programs, on the other hand, concentrate on matching workers whose roles are at threat great post to read of redundancy with offered settings within the business. This approach not just assists maintain beneficial ability however likewise reduces the unfavorable influence of labor force reduction on morale and efficiency. With effective redeployment methods, employers can minimize the potential lawful risks connected with redundancies, such as unfair termination claims. In general, retraining and redeployment programs play a critical role in promoting a positive business society during times of adjustment and uncertainty.
